janvier 12, 2007 Archives

ven jan 12 16:02:59 CET 2007

Fin du déménagement...

Notre appartement est enfin fini de déménager, les réfections sont finies aussi.
Et grande nouvelle pour nous, cet appartement après visite d'une nana, sera reloué pour le 26 janvier ! Yeah!!! Cela ne nous fera qu'un seul double loyer à payer. Ceci sachant que notre bail se finissait le 3 mars. Kweel !!!

   

Est-ce que votre processeur est un intel en utilisant CPUID ?!?

static inline void verify_intel_proc()
{
        unsigned int ebx, ecx, edx;
	/* eax == 0 */
        __asm__ ("xorl %%eax, %%eax\n"
                 "cpuid"
                 : "=b" (ebx), "=c" (ecx), "=d" (edx)
                 :
                 : "ax");
        /* value from : intel vol 3, chap 3, CPUID instr */
        if (ebx == 0x756e6547 && edx == 0x49656e69 && ecx == 0x6c65746e) {
                printk("CPU is a GenuineIntel.\n");
        } else {
                printk("CPU is not an Intel CPU.\n");
        }
}
Vili, j'avance un ti peu sur la détection du processeur avec CPUID...

Ah oui pour les lutins, un petit lien pour concernant la compilation et les paramètres du noyau, par le gars Greg !!! Librement téléchargeable et sous Licence : Creative Commons Attribution-ShareAlike 2.5 license
=> http://www.kroah.com/lkn/

Linux Kernel in a Nutshell cover image -----